About Agasthyamalai Community Conservation Centre:
Agasthyamalai Community Conservation Centre, a 4.5 acres campus established in the foothills of the Agasthyamalai in 2001. The overall goal was to understand how ecosystems respond to natural and anthropogenic changes and what governing mechanisms and management regimes exist in the region to address specific biodiversity conservation issues. It enables interaction with diverse groups of local stakeholders, imbibe community knowledge and build capacity and leadership to address conservation issues in and around the iconic Kalakad Mundanthurai Tiger Reserve (KMTR). The geographical focus of ACCC is the eastern slopes of the Agasthyamalai Hill range which is a source for many rivers that seamlessly merge to form the perennial river Tamiraparani which straddles the three districts of Tirunelveli, Tenkasi and Thoothukudi in southern Tamil Nadu. River Tamiraparani is the lifeline that traverses through the parched and arid landscape (12,000 km2) sustaining extensive paddy and banana agriculture, harbouring important social, cultural and biodiversity landmarks.
